Understanding Bandhavgarh’s Climate
Bandhavgarh experiences a tropical climate with distinct seasons. The weather patterns heavily influence wildlife activity and visibility. Understanding these seasonal variations is key to planning your trip effectively.
Summer (April – June)
Summers in Bandhavgarh are hot and dry, with temperatures soaring above 40°C (104°F). This season is generally considered the least favorable for wildlife viewing as animals seek refuge from the scorching heat. However, if you’re an avid photographer, the clear skies and low humidity can provide excellent opportunities for capturing stunning landscapes.
Monsoon (July – September)
The monsoon season brings much-needed relief from the summer heat, transforming the landscape into a lush green paradise. While the rains can sometimes hinder visibility, they also bring a surge in wildlife activity as animals come out to graze and drink. This season is ideal for spotting animals like deer, wild boar, and sloth bears.
Winter (October – March)
Winter is the peak season for wildlife viewing in Bandhavgarh. Temperatures are pleasant, ranging from 10°C to 25°C (50°F to 77°F), and the dry conditions offer excellent visibility. Tigers are most active during this time, making it a prime opportunity for tiger sightings.
Best Time to Visit for Tiger Sightings
While tigers can be spotted year-round in Bandhavgarh, the best time for maximizing your chances of a tiger encounter is during the winter months (October to March). During this period, the dry weather and clear skies provide optimal visibility, and tigers are more active as they search for prey in the open grasslands. Other Wildlife Encounters
Beyond tigers, Bandhavgarh is home to a diverse array of wildlife. Here’s a breakdown of the best time to see specific animals:
* **Leopards:** Leopards are more elusive than tigers but can be spotted year-round. Winter months offer the best chances due to increased activity.
* **Sloth Bears:** Sloth bears are most active during the monsoon season (July to September) when they forage for fruits and insects.
* **Deer:** Deer are abundant in Bandhavgarh and can be seen throughout the year.
